    Abstract: In a method for continuously preparing crude ethylene sulfate, a sulfur trioxide solution is prepared by dissolving sulfur trioxide with a solution A, an ethylene oxide solution is prepared by mixing a solution B with ethylene oxide, the sulfur trioxide solution and the ethylene oxide solution are pre-cooled, and introduced into a set of microchannel reactors for a real-time reaction to obtain a mixed solution containing crude ethylene sulfate, and then a post-treatment process is carried out to obtain crude ethylene sulfate. With the process, the reaction selectivity is good, and a microchannel reaction can accurately control the reaction energy level due to its rapid mixing and timely heat transfer, which greatly reduces the safety risk and effectively avoids the occurrence of side reactions. One-step synthesis is realized, the atomic economic benefits are significantly improved, and thus the process is a typical low-carbon green chemical reaction.

    Abstract: An photoelectric conversion element in the disclosure is characterized by including: a first conductive layer; a porous hole-blocking layer disposed on the first conductive layer; a porous insulator layer disposed on the porous hole-blocking layer; photoabsorption layers disposed in a pore of the porous hole-blocking layer and in a pore of the porous insulator layer and containing an organic-based photoelectric conversion material; an electron-blocking layer disposed on the porous insulator layer; and a second conductive layer disposed on the electron-blocking layer.
